Spatial and temporal analysis of soil organic carbon at the regional scale (Belgium)

It is generally recognized that soils represent a major pool in the global C-cycle, as they contain more organic carbon than the atmosphere and biosphere together. As soil organic carbon (SOC) is a dynamic soil property, monitoring SOC is crucial in the framework of international treaties facing climate change (e.g. Kyoto protocol) and directives considering soil quality (e.g. EU Soil Thematic Strategy).
